WOOD-FIRED ITALIAN CRUST CORNED BEEF CELTIC CREAM SAUCEFRIED SHOESTRING POTATOES GUINNESS HONEY GLAZEMOZZARELLA & PROVOLONE FRESH CHIVES **Our annual St. Patrick's Day Pizza** There used to be this Irish-themed restaurant chain called Bennigan's. (I just googled it and there are still 10 of them out there!) Anyway, they had this Guinness Honey Glaze that they'd put on a burger. Sweet and savory at the same time with the tinyest bit of a bit. A few St Patty's ago I figured out the Guinness glaze recipe for this special pizza. I make a celtic cream sauce that's laced with some whole grain mustard and chives. It's a take on a common pan sauce that gets served with pork in pockets of Ireland. But with corned beef it's almost silly how perfectly they go together. I top that with cheese, then top that with a big smattering of fried shoestring potatoes for a fantastic crunch. It's hard to do Irish food justice without a lil 'tato snuck in.
